Benchmark Investment Advisors LLC Has $1.42 Million Stake in Synopsys, Inc. (NASDAQ:SNPS)

Benchmark Investment Advisors LLC trimmed its position in shares of Synopsys, Inc. (NASDAQ:SNPSFree Report) by 12.4% during the fourth quarter, according to the company in its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The institutional investor owned 2,915 shares of the semiconductor company’s stock after selling 414 shares during the quarter. Benchmark Investment Advisors LLC’s holdings in Synopsys were worth $1,415,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

Insider Transactions at Synopsys

In other Synopsys news, insider Geus Aart De sold 15,705 shares of the business’s stock in a transaction that occurred on Thursday, March 6th. The stock was sold at an average price of $444.42, for a total transaction of $6,979,616.10. Following the transaction, the insider now owns 116,671 shares of the company’s stock, valued at $51,850,925.82. The trade was a 11.86 % decrease in their ownership of the stock. Synopsys Profile

(Free Report)

Synopsys, Inc provides electronic design automation software products used to design and test integrated circuits. It operates in three segments: Design Automation, Design IP, and Software Integrity. The company offers Digital and Custom IC Design solution that provides digital design implementation solutions; Verification solution that offers virtual prototyping, static and formal verification, simulation, emulation, field programmable gate array (FPGA)-based prototyping, and debug solutions; and FPGA design products that are programmed to perform specific functions.
